Hirotaka Uchizono (内薗大貴, Uchizono, Hirotaka, born 27 April 1987 in Ibusuki, Kagoshima) is a Japanese footballer who plays for Kagoshima United FC.[1]

Personal information
Full name Hirotaka Uchizono
Date of birth (1987-04-27) 27 April 1987
Place of birth Ibusuki, Kagoshima, Japan
Height 1.80 m (5 ft 11 in)
Playing position(s) Midfielder
Club information
Current team
Kagoshima United FC
Number 15
Youth career
2006–2009 Tokai Gakuen University
Senior career*
Years Team Apps (Gls)
2009 FC Kariya 10 (0)
2010–2013 FC Kagoshima 25 (3)
2014– Kagoshima United FC 45 (1)
* Senior club appearances and goals counted for the domestic league only and correct as of 23 February 2017
